I have seen this with the three blades. My friend shot a deer and seen the same results you did. We came to the conclusion that he took a quartering shot. Since the head did not hit square this caused one of the blades to deploy before the other two basically locking them down.
Was your shot a quartering?
I contacted Field Logic with an email say I thought there was a design flaw with the three blades. They told me to send in my three blades and they would send me the two. So I gathered two of my friends and mine three blades (even the used and broken ones) and sent them in. They replaced them with new three blades which I took to Scheels and they traded me for the two blades.
I have switched back to Reapers I feel they are a much stronger and easier head to keep closed.
